From 41e00172c51a1666cbcda5df2c6f45d685068fbb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Evan Cheng Date: Mon, 14 Nov 2011 21:02:09 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] At -O0, multiple uses of a virtual registers in the same BB are being marked "kill". This looks like a bug upstream. Since that's going to take some time to understand, loosen the assertion and disable the optimization when multiple kills are seen.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@144568 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8 --- lib/CodeGen/TwoAddressInstructionPass.cpp | 3 ++- 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/lib/CodeGen/TwoAddressInstructionPass.cpp b/lib/CodeGen/TwoAddressInstructionPass.cpp index 33ed4cc907a..a702c6c8407 100644 --- a/lib/CodeGen/TwoAddressInstructionPass.cpp +++ b/lib/CodeGen/TwoAddressInstructionPass.cpp @@ -502,7 +502,8 @@ MachineInstr *findLocalKill(unsigned Reg, MachineBasicBlock *MBB, continue; if (!UI.getOperand().isKill()) return 0; - assert(!KillMI && "More than one local kills?"); + if (KillMI) + return 0; // -O0 kill markers cannot be trusted?
